Transmission and Detection of Squeezed States of Light through an Optical Fiber with a Real-time True Local Oscillator

Abstract

We demonstrate transmission and homodyne detection of 1550 nm squeezed light through up to 10 km single-mode fiber with a real-time independent local oscillator, measuring up to 3.6 dB of squeezing below vacuum noise.
